Explore printable Leaf Anatomy worksheets for Class 5
Leaf anatomy worksheets for Class 5 students available through Wayground (formerly Quizizz) provide comprehensive exploration of plant leaf structures and their essential functions. These educational resources guide fifth-grade learners through the intricate world of leaf components, including the epidermis, mesophyll layers, vascular bundles, and stomata, helping students understand how each part contributes to photosynthesis and transpiration. The worksheets strengthen critical scientific observation skills, vocabulary development, and conceptual understanding through carefully designed practice problems that encourage students to identify, label, and explain leaf structures. Each resource includes detailed answer keys and is available as free printables in pdf format, making it easy for educators to implement hands-on learning experiences that connect microscopic leaf anatomy to larger biological processes.
